Summary
This agreement grants Independent Brokers Network the right to purchase up to 15,000 shares of common stock in Mortgage.com, Inc. at a set price of $2.69 per share. The warrant vests in increments of 20% upon meeting specific performance milestones related to a separate Marketing Agreement. The warrant expires on April 11, 2004, or earlier if the Marketing Agreement ends, with a 60-day window to exercise vested portions after termination. Shares acquired are for investment purposes only and are subject to transfer restrictions and securities law compliance.

April 12, 2000 COMMON STOCK WARRANT To Purchase 15,000 Shares of common stock of MORTGAGE.COM, INC. THIS CERTIFIES THAT, in consideration for payment of good and valuable consideration to Mortgage.com, Inc., a Florida corporation (the "Company"), Independent Brokers Network or registered assigns is entitled to subscribe for and purchase from the Company, subject to the terms and conditions described below, 15,000 fully-paid and nonassessable shares of the Company's common stock, $0.01 par value (the "Shares"), at the Exercise Price. 1. Definitions. Capitalized terms used herein but not defined herein shall have the meanings given to them in the Marketing Agreement. The following capitalized terms, as used herein, shall have the meanings set forth below: (a) "Exercise Price" shall mean $2.69, subject to adjustments described in Section 8. (b) "Extraordinary Common Stock Event" shall mean (i) the issue of additional shares of common stock as a dividend or other distribution on outstanding shares of capital stock, (ii) a subdivision of outstanding shares of common stock into a greater number of shares of common stock (whether by stock split or otherwise than by payment of a dividend in common stock) or (iii) a subdivision of outstanding shares of common stock into a smaller number of shares of the common stock (whether by combination or reverse stock split). (c) "Marketing Agreement" shall mean the Marketing and Management Agreement dated April 10, 2000, between the Company and Independent Brokers Network. (d) "Monthly Penetration Rate" shall mean the percentage obtained by dividing "B" by "A": "A" = The number of monthly real estate transactions closed by a Contact who has signed up for a Company Program where the Contact represented the buyer in such real estate transaction. "B" = The number of monthly mortgage loans associated with the real estate transactions determined in "A" which a Contact caused to be closed pursuant to a Company Program. 2. Term of Warrant and Vesting. The term of this Warrant shall expire at 11:59 p.m. on April 11, 2004. Notwithstanding the expiration date, unvested portions of this Warrant expire on the termination date of the Marketing Agreement. The holder may exercise vested portions of this Warrant for a period of 60 days following the termination date of the Marketing Agreement; provided that no portion of this Warrant shall be exercisable after the time it would otherwise have expired. This Warrant shall vest 20% upon the occurrence of each of the following events: (a) At such time as Independent Brokers Network, pursuant to the Marketing Agreement, has caused 18 Contacts to sign up for the Company's Programs, and each such Contact has closed at least 5 mortgage loans with the Company pursuant to the Programs; (b) At such time as Independent Brokers Network, pursuant to the Marketing Agreement, has caused 50 Contacts to sign up for the Company's Programs, and such Contacts have closed an aggregate of at least 300 mortgage loans with the Company pursuant to the Programs; (c) At such time as the Independent Brokers Network Contacts who have signed up for the Company's Programs have closed an aggregate of at least 400 mortgage loans with the Company pursuant to the Programs; (d) At such time as Independent Brokers Network, pursuant to the Marketing Agreement, has caused 20 Contacts to sign up for the Company's Programs and such Contacts in the aggregate have maintained an average Monthly Penetration Rate in excess of 20% over any consecutive period of 24 months during the term of this Warrant, provided that at least 20 Contacts participated in the Company's Programs for each of those 24 months. (e) At such time as Independent Brokers Network, pursuant to the Marketing Agreement, has caused 20 Contacts to sign up for the Company's Programs and such Contacts in the aggregate have maintained an average Monthly Penetration Rate in excess of 30% over any consecutive period of 12 months during the term of this Warrant, provided that at least 20 Contacts participated in the Company's Programs for each of those 12 months. 3. Anti-Dilution Adjustments. The above provisions are subject to the following: (a) Upon Extraordinary Common Stock Event. Upon the happening of an Extraordinary Common Stock Event, the Exercise Price shall, simultaneously with the happening of such Extraordinary Common Stock Event, be adjusted by multiplying the Exercise Price by a fraction, the numerator of which shall be the number of shares of common stock outstanding immediately prior to such Extraordinary Common Stock Event and the denominator of which shall be the number of shares of common stock outstanding immediately after such Extraordinary Common Stock Event, and the product so obtained shall thereafter be the Exercise Price. The Exercise Price, as so adjusted, shall be readjusted in the same manner upon the happening of any successive Extraordinary Common Stock Event or Events. When any adjustment is required to be made in the Exercise Price pursuant to this subsection (a), the number of Shares purchasable upon the exercise of this Warrant shall be changed to the number determined by dividing (i) (A) an amount equal to the number of shares issuable upon the exercise of this Warrant immediately prior to such adjustment, multiplied by (B) the Exercise Price in effect immediately prior to such adjustment, by (ii) the Exercise Price in effect immediately after such adjustment. (b) Mergers, Consolidations, Sales of Assets, Etc. In the event of any consolidation of the Company with or merger of the Company into any other corporation (other than a merger in which the Company is the surviving corporation unless the Company is the surviving target corporation in a reverse triangular merger) or the conveyance, transfer or lease of substantially all of the Company's assets or a recapitalization or reclassification that results in the issuance of the Company's securities, the holder of this Warrant shall have the right, after such consolidation, merger, sale, recapitalization or reclassification to exercise such Warrant and receive the number and kind of shares of stock or other securities and the amount and kind of property receivable upon such consolidation, merger, sale, recapitalization or reclassification as would a holder of the number of shares of common stock issuable upon exercise of this Warrant immediately prior to such consolidation, merger or sale. Provisions shall be made for adjustments in the Exercise Price which shall be as nearly equivalent as may be practicable to the adjustments provided for in subsection (a). The provisions of this subsection (b) shall 4 similarly apply to successive consolidations, mergers, sales, recapitalizations or reclassifications. (c) Notice of Certain Transactions. If the Company takes any action that would require an adjustment in the Exercise Price, the Company shall mail to the holder of this Warrant a notice stating the proposed record date for a dividend or distribution or the proposed effective date of a subdivision, combination, reclassification, consolidation or merger and a description of the resulting adjustment. The Company shall mail the notice at least 15 days before such date. Failure to mail the notice or any defect contained therein shall not affect the validity of the transaction. (d) No Impairment. The Company will not, by any voluntary action, avoid or seek to avoid the observance or performance of any of the terms to be observed or performed hereunder by the Company, but will at all times in good faith assist in the carrying out of all the provisions of this Section 5 and in the taking of all such action as may be necessary or appropriate in order to protect the rights of the holder of this Warrant against impairment. 9.
